A recent report from U.S. News Money highlights several biotech exchange-traded funds (ETFs) as potential options for investors seeking exposure to the dynamic biotechnology sector. The article underscores the sector’s innovation-driven growth potential while acknowledging its inherent volatility and regulatory risks.

Live News

According to a recent analysis published by U.S. News Money, biotechnology ETFs continue to capture investor attention as the sector benefits from advancements in gene editing, precision medicine, and drug development pipelines. The report notes that these funds offer diversified access to companies spanning early-stage biotech firms to established pharmaceutical leaders. The article lists seven biotech ETFs that could be considered by investors, though specific fund names, performance figures, or target prices are not reproduced here due to source limitations. The analysis emphasizes that biotech ETFs may provide a balanced approach to investing in a high-risk, high-reward industry, where individual stock selection can be challenging. Key themes in the report include the potential impact of upcoming drug approvals, ongoing research into rare diseases and oncology treatments, and the growing role of artificial intelligence in drug discovery. The author cautions that biotech stocks often experience sharp price movements based on clinical trial results or regulatory decisions, making ETFs a way to mitigate single-stock risk. Key Highlights

- Diversification in a volatile sector: Biotech ETFs may help spread risk across multiple companies, reducing the impact of any single clinical trial failure or regulatory setback. - Innovation as a driver: The sector’s long-term growth potential is closely linked to breakthroughs in areas such as CRISPR, immuno-oncology, and neurodegenerative disease treatments. - Regulatory and pipeline risks: FDA decisions, patent expirations, and reimbursement changes can significantly influence biotech valuations. ETFs may offer a smoother ride through these uncertainties. - Cost considerations: Expense ratios and index methodology vary across biotech ETFs, potentially affecting net returns for long-term holders. - No earnings data available: As of the publication date, no recent biotech ETF earnings or specific fund performance figures are included in the source material. Expert Insights

Investment professionals caution that while biotech ETFs can be a compelling tool for capitalizing on medical innovation, they are not without risks. The sector’s sensitivity to macroeconomic factors—such as interest rates and healthcare policy changes—adds another layer of uncertainty. “Biotech investing requires a tolerance for periodic drawdowns, but ETFs can help investors stay committed to the theme without the anxiety of single-stock outcomes,” suggests industry commentary cited in the report. For those considering biotech ETFs, a long-term horizon and a focus on funds with transparent holdings and reasonable fees may be prudent. Investors are advised to align any biotech allocation with their overall risk profile and to monitor sector developments, including pipeline milestones and regulatory updates, rather than relying on short-term price movements. As always, past performance does not guarantee future results, and due diligence remains essential.
